A self build bridging loan is a short-term secured funding solution designed to help borrowers acquire land, fund early-stage construction, or bridge a temporary funding gap before arranging long-term self build finance.
For many self build projects, speed is critical. Land opportunities can move quickly, planning timelines can shift, and traditional lenders may not be able to provide funding within the required timeframe.
This is where self build bridging finance becomes particularly valuable.
Rather than waiting for a full construction finance package to be approved, borrowers can use bridging finance to secure the site and progress the project without delay.

A clear exit strategy is essential.
Common repayment routes include:
Many borrowers refinance onto a specialist self build mortgage or staged construction facility.
Larger projects may transition onto structured development finance.
Some borrowers sell the completed property following construction.
Repayment can also come from wider asset sales or liquidity events.
